The Importance of Purity in Chemical Raw supplies for Electroless Nickel Plating

Purity is paramount In terms of chemical raw resources Employed in the electroless nickel plating procedure. Impurities can cause inconsistent plating outcomes, cutting down the general top quality from the coated floor. superior-purity chemical substances make certain that the plating system operates effortlessly, providing a uniform coating that satisfies industrial requirements. within the electroless nickel approach, even trace quantities of contaminants can result in defects including pits, blisters, or bad adhesion, which compromise the functionality and aesthetics of the final item. Ensuring that the raw supplies meet up with stringent purity requirements is essential for attaining the specified final results regularly.

How substantial-top quality Raw components result in excellent Electroless Nickel Coatings

higher-quality raw supplies are definitely the bedrock of outstanding electroless nickel coatings. For example, Fengfan's Environmentally Medium Phosphorus Electroless Nickel Process, FF-607, offers a phosphorus content material of seven to nine%, plus a hardness starting from 550 to 600 HV. After heat treatment method, the hardness can reach around 1000 HV. this kind of precise technical specs are probable only when large-high-quality Uncooked products are applied. The excellent bonding power on medium and reduced carbon metal, which often can reach up to 450 MPa, more exemplifies the value of excellent Uncooked products. When the Uncooked products are of premium high quality, the resultant nickel layer reveals outstanding soldering overall performance, uniformity, and also a vibrant, reliable gloss in the course of its services existence.

The job of Chemical regularity in accomplishing Optimal Plating final results

Consistency in chemical raw resources plays a pivotal role in accomplishing ideal leads to electroless nickel plating. Variations in chemical composition can lead to fluctuations while in the plating course of action, causing uneven coatings and subpar excellent. Using Uncooked materials with steady chemical properties makes sure that the plating tub remains stable, producing a uniform nickel layer with predictable Qualities. Fengfan's FF-607 approach, for instance, provides a secure plating Answer having a lengthy support life of up to 8 MTO (Metal Turnover), ensuring constant overall performance more than extended durations. The regular quality of raw products allows preserve the desired plating velocity of 1 micron for every three minutes, reaching a uniform, electroless nickel process white, and brilliant layer with no require for additional processing.
